The Human Element in AI Love:
The idea of AI love is not a new concept. In fact, it has been explored in science fiction for decades. However, with the rapid advancements in technology, it is becoming increasingly plausible that AI could develop emotions and form relationships with humans. But what exactly is the human element in AI love and why do we find the idea so intriguing?
At its core, the human element in AI love is the desire to have a connection with another being, even if that being is not human. We are social creatures and crave companionship, and the idea of a machine being able to fulfill that need is both fascinating and frightening. It raises questions about our own emotions and what it means to truly love and be loved.
But can AI truly experience emotions and form meaningful connections with humans? Some argue that it is simply a product of our own projections and desires. We are the ones programming and creating these machines, so it is natural for us to project our own emotions onto them. Others believe that AI can develop genuine emotions and connections, just like humans.

The Human Element in AI Love: Can We Truly Connect with Machines?
One of the key components of love is empathy, the ability to understand and share the feelings of another. Can AI develop empathy, or is it simply mimicking human behavior? Some researchers believe that it is possible for AI to develop empathy through advanced algorithms and machine learning. However, others argue that true empathy goes beyond just understanding and requires a deeper level of emotional intelligence that may not be achievable for machines.
Another aspect of the human element in AI love is the concept of vulnerability. In order to truly connect with another being, we must be willing to open ourselves up and be vulnerable. This vulnerability allows for trust and intimacy to develop. Can AI be vulnerable? Can we trust a machine with our deepest thoughts and emotions? These are questions that require further exploration and consideration.
Current Event:
A recent current event that highlights the potential for human-AI relationships is the launch of the world’s first AI virtual influencer, Lil Miquela. Created by a startup called Brud, Lil Miquela has amassed a massive following on social media, with over 3 million followers on Instagram alone. She posts sponsored content, promotes brands, and even has her own music career.
While Lil Miquela is not technically capable of love or emotions, her popularity raises questions about the potential for AI to become influential figures in our lives. As AI technology continues to advance, it is not hard to imagine a future where virtual influencers like Lil Miquela could become even more human-like, blurring the lines between reality and AI.
The ethical implications of this are vast. Should we be promoting and idolizing virtual beings? What impact could this have on our society and our relationships with each other? These are important questions to consider as we continue to integrate AI into our daily lives.
